Compact Type B, size:5 x 24, 3237 sq in, copper-nickel tubes

Compact-B exchangers are designed for mounting off the engine, in a vertical or horizontal position. They are designed as single pass on the shell and three pass on the tube side. Hose connections are oriented to one side for ease of routing from an exchanger mounted on the deck or bulkhead. No expansion tank is incorporated in the exchanger, relying instead on an external expansion tank or an overflow recovery bottle to capture coolant volumes which exceed system capacity in operation, and return them to the cooling system when it cools down. Coolant is added to the system via a separately mounted fill neck with pressure cap. The shell is completely packed with tubing, providing the maximum heat transfer surface possible for each set of external dimensions. This exchanger is illustrated without a mounting bracket. We have mounting brackets for virtually any mounting configuration. The exchanger is mounted on the bracket with cushioning material, and held in position with stainless steel clamps (sold separately). All exchangers are supplied with a zinc anode. All Raw Water and Coolant connections are beaded hose connections. Other styles and dimensions are available on request. Compact Type C, size:4 x 16, 1348 sq in, copper-nickel tubes

Compact-C exchangers are single pass on the shell side, 3 pass on the tube (raw water) side. These exchangers have no expansion tank integrated into their design, and rely instead on an external expansion tank or the overflow recovery bottle to capture coolant volumes which exceed system capacity in operation, and return them to the cooling system when it cools down. Coolant is added to the system via an integral fill neck with pressure cap. The shell is completely packed with tubing, providing the maximum heat transfer surface possible for each set of external dimensions. This exchanger is illustrated without a mounting bracket. We have mounting brackets for virtually any mounting configuration. The exchanger is mounted on the bracket with cushioning material, and held in position with stainless steel clamps (sold separately). All exchangers are supplied with a zinc anode. All Raw Water and Coolant connections are beaded hose connections. Other styles and dimensions are available on request. Low Profile, size:4 x 16, 888 sq in, copper-nickel tubes

Low Profile exchangers are single pass on the shell side, 3 pass on the tube (raw water) side. These exchangers have an expansion tank, located in the upper portion of the shell, providing space for expansion without adding the height, as is required with the 'Piggy Back' design. This exchanger is illustrated without a mounting bracket. We have mounting brackets for virtually any mounting configuration. The exchanger is mounted on the bracket with cushioning material, and held in position with stainless steel clamps (sold separately). All exchangers are supplied with a zinc anode. All Raw Water and Coolant connections are beaded hose connections. Other styles and dimensions are available on request.
